The Evolution of Power Tools

Over the years, the power tool industry has witnessed an extraordinary evolution, driven by the constant demand for efficiency, sustainability, and user-friendliness. Traditionally, gas-powered chainsaws have been the mainstay for forestry, construction, and landscaping professionals. While they offer immense power and reliability, they also come with considerable disadvantages, including the operational noise, emissions, and the necessity of maintenance associated with fuel and lubrication systems.

Enter Stihl’s battery-powered chainsaws, which represent a new paradigm in power tool technology. By leveraging cutting-edge battery technology and eco-friendly design, Stihl has created chainsaws that not only meet but surpass many of the performance expectations of traditional gas models, all while addressing the environmental and operational drawbacks of their predecessors.

Maintenance and Operational Simplicity

One of the standout advantages of Stihl’s battery-powered chainsaws lies in their reduced maintenance requirements. Traditional gas chainsaws demand regular oil changes, air filter replacements, and other maintenance routines that can be time-consuming and costly. In contrast, battery-powered models simplify operations by eliminating these routine tasks.

The lithium-ion batteries used in these chainsaws have a longer lifespan than gas-powered counterparts’ fuel systems. Typically, these batteries can last for several years, reducing the frequency of replacements. Charging these batteries is straightforward—simply plug in and charge using the provided charger. This process takes much less time compared to refueling and oil changes associated with gas models, ultimately leading to greater operational efficiency and lower maintenance costs.

FAQ Section

Are Stihl’s battery-powered chainsaws as powerful as gas models?

Absolutely. Stihl’s battery-powered chainsaws are engineered to deliver power equivalent to their gas-powered counterparts. The advanced battery technology ensures that these chainsaws maintain the necessary cutting force and efficiency, ensuring they can handle heavy-duty tasks effectively.

How long do the batteries last?

The battery life varies by model but typically, one charge can last between 30 to 60 minutes of continuous operation. This performance ensures that professionals can complete significant volumes of work with minimal downtime for battery replacement or charging.

What is the charging time for the batteries?

Charging times for the lithium-ion batteries are designed to be efficient. Typically, it takes about 3 to 6 hours to fully charge a battery, depending on the specific model and charger used. However, quick-charge options are available for situations requiring faster turnaround.
